aging skinI’m a cosmetology student, I need to do work relating to the behavior of the skin, my question is: why we age? Thanks

Living things need oxygen but its metabolism produces free radicals, which are natural waste. These molecules are highly reactive chemical that oxidizes the cell, as if it were an old iron exposed to the weather. To avoid the proliferation of free radicals have cells that activate antioxidant mechanisms. Over time these mechanisms begin to fail and there are a greater accumulation of free radicals which deteriorate the cell. The most visible consequence is the appearance of wrinkles but it is the same at all levels of our body, so systems are disrupted energy production in cells, causing physical and mental fatigue.

male skinThe skin of men and women are different. Mainly there are three physiological factors that differentiate them: the thickness, firmness and sebum production. It is a type of skin fat than women whose main problem is the brightness. As this is a different skin should be careful with specific products.

The characteristics of male skin makes hygiene habits are different from those of female skins. This is because men’s skin is 24% thicker than women, so it is more resistant. Also, the man’s skin is firmer, but later ages, however, more abrupt. Furthermore, the amount of fat secreted by the human skin is much greater for hormonal reasons. Therefore, you have more blemishes and shine, especially in the area T. However, the skin of the cheeks and neck, when subjected to shaving, has a greater tendency to dehydration and dryness.

Over time the skin is persistent aggression by the effects of sun exposure, and the natural atrophy of the tissues. Signs of aging are caused by loss of skin elasticity and the action of gravity, which modify the facial volume, resulting in a sad and tired, decreasing the brightness of the skin, wrinkles, and stains.

More and more men and women seeking cosmetic medicine response to combat the effects of aging. If the time took some of the beauty of the individual, aesthetic medicine should help it recover, not to invent a new beauty.

The age of onset of aging begins between 25 and 30 years. This is not an exclusively skin, but is an event that happens in multiple layers over time. Therefore, a treatment that improves skin quality will have virtually no effect on the deeper layers and vice versa.

The concept of anti-aging, involves an area of medicine a patient receives interested in looking good, the important thing is prevention, the goal is to anticipate the appearance of wrinkles through noninvasive procedures that maintain the natural features.
